Lanier Village resident's painting on display at state Capitol

GAINESVILLE - A painting by an 81-year-old Lanier Village Estates resident will be on display at the state Capitol for the next 6-8 months.

Ruth Money has been painting for seven years and her daughter is also an artist. They have put on art shows together and Money has featured her work in individual shows.

The work, a 16x20 oil on canvas, which is hanging in the Executive Offices at the state Capitol, is an interpretation of Northeast Georgia. It went on display today.
